Перенаправление HTTP на HTTPS с использованием файла .htaccess не работает - PullRequest
0 голосов
/ 14 мая 2018
RewriteEngine On
RewriteCond %{HTTPS} off
R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]

ErrorDocument 404 https://whatmovieshouldiwatchtoday.com/error404.php

php_flag display_errors 1

RewriteEngine On
RewriteRule ^/?movie/([0-9A-Za-z-:-]+)/?$ /movie.php?id=$1 [NC,L] 

RewriteEngine On
RewriteRule ^/?cast/([0-9A-Za-z-:-]+)/?$ /cast.php?cast=$1 [NC,L] 

RewriteEngine On
RewriteRule ^/?keyword/([0-9A-Za-z-:-]+)/?$ /keyword.php?keyword=$1 [NC,L] 

Это мой код, теперь предполагается, что эта часть кода перенаправляет HTTP на https, но он не работает:

RewriteEngine On
RewriteCond %{HTTPS} off
R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]

Когда я пытаюсь открыть свой сайт (даже сhttps), Google Chrome показывает «В ожидании Whatmovieshouldiwatchtoday.com» и через несколько секунд показывает

Эта страница не работает

whatmovieshouldiwatchtoday.com перенаправил вас слишком много раз.

Попробуйте очистить куки.

ERR_TOO_MANY_REDIRECTS

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...